USKP Fixes

  • 02058EDE, 02058EDF: Beds previously added in the Windhelm East Empire Company Warehouse were mistakenly placed above the surface of the floor. One of the beds [02058EDE] also needed to be relocated since it was partially placed on an uneven part of the floor. The navmesh needed to be edited as a result. (Bug #19370)
  • Reverted edit to form 0010FF5D because it leaves behind a forever looping sound. The original bug should have been dealt with by commenting out the bad line in the script instead. (MG08BarrierRefScript) (Bug #19352)
  • When soul trapping a non-humanoid Actor that was set up as a ghost, and had the default ghost loot flag set, there was a possibility that all empty black soul gems and The Black Star would be permanently lost due to the way in which ghosts with the default loot flag handle swapping the items before turning into an ash pile. This problem has now been eliminated by using a dedicated dummy NPC in a USKP test cell so that these items can no longer become lost. (Bug #19297)
  • Drowned Sorrows (FreeformWinterholdC) was shutting down prematurely due to an unknown change that was made to the ending scene to terminate the quest. (Bug #19395)
  • Reverted changes to CWExiledSonsSandboxBrunwulfsHouse -- this package deliberately does not send Korir and family to the Palace of the Kings because there is not enough space for them there.
  • QF_dunStonehillBarrowQST_000CF915: Corrected an error that caused killing bandits in the quest area to open their inventories to the player. (Bug #19441)
  • Evette San stopped handing out free spiced wine to female players due to a script added by the USKP that later went missing. (Bug #19444)

Quest Fixes

  • Fixing WITavern revealed a secondary bug that caused Delphine's scene with Orgnar in the Sleeping Giant to fail, resulting in her being permanently stuck in her room. (Bug #19368)
  • The quest that restrains Ogmund (FreeformMarkarthMPostQuest) was not properly holding him in the stockade and was also not releasing him if the Stormcloaks took control of The Reach. (Bug #19344)
  • Repentance (dunDarklightQST) is never shut down once Illia agrees to join you as a follower. (Bug #19133)
  • Olava's greetings don't make sense in the order they're given in DialogueWhiterun. (Bug #19322)
  • After The Dainty Sload (TGTQ02) the Balmora Blue is not removed from the chest. (Bug #19340) [NR]
  • Irileth follows Balgruuf to High Hrothgar if Message to Whiterun (CW03) is running alongside Season Unending (MQ302), but she shouldn't do this because she will disrupt the proceedings. (Bug #19366)
  • Whiterun guards should not be talking about killing Imperials once the city has chosen a side in the war. (Bug #19315)
  • Eltrys' body is never properly cleaned up at the end of The Forsworn Conspiracy (MS01.) (Bug #19389) [NR]
  • After Fit for a Jarl (SolitudeFreeform02), Taarie's friendship rank with the player is never raised which then makes it impossible to marry her even though she's set up for marriage. (Bug #19403)
  • If the player joins the Stormcloaks (either initially or by defecting after Jagged Crown) the quest where the player can pick up free Imperial gear (CW01AOutfitImperial) is never shut down which leaves Beirand in a perpetual essential alias. (Bug #19402)
  • If the player defects to the Stormcloaks at the end of Jagged Crown (CW02A), Ulfric's closing lines that explain the significance of delivering an axe to Balgruuf will not be available like they are if you join the Stormcloaks normally. (Bug #19407)
  • Revyn Sadri stops offering training after marriage due to a bad dialogue condition check. (Bug #19390)
  • In Unfathomable Depths (MS04), From-Deepest-Fathoms has a dialogue line that was given a post process effect that was improperly used. The dialogue line containing it has been blocked off since it cannot be fixed. (Bug #19393)
  • During Missing in Action (MS09) the Gray-Mane house is never set temporarily to public access which results in the player being accused of trespassing. (Bug #19387)
  • In Blood on the Ice (MS11) it was possible to accuse Wuunferth without having taken possession of the amulet because the amulet and the butcher flyers both share the same script which was only setting a quest stage. Two tracking variables have been added to make sure that BOTH clues are required to make the accusation, as intended. (Bug #19281)
  • At the end of Discerning the Transmundane (DA04) Septimus Signus dissolves before completing the audio for his final line due to the ascension script being in the wrong scene phase fragment. (Bug #18698)

Script Fixes

  • TGDoorCloserTriggerScript: Activation command using the player reference causes any invisibility spells to abort. (Bug #19360)
  • MGRArniel03SContainerScript: OnMagicEffectApply event continues counting hits on the convectors when it should only register on the 16th hit. This then results in item duplication which can disrupt the associated quest. (Bug #19353)
  • DragonActorScript: Scenes for when the player kills a dragon and starts to absorb the soul are skipping dialogue due to the order of two statements in the OnDeath event. (Bug #19214)
  • dunMzinchaleftGateAttentionScript: Called activate on itself which resulted in a loop that the script VM eventually stops. (Bug #18588)
  • WERoad08LetterScript: Sanity check for reading it if the quest is already stopped. (Bug #18316)
  • MQ304LostSoulScript: Sanity check to prevent massive spam flow into the logs when the lost soul trigger returns a NONE. (Bug #14263)
  • dunProgressiveCombatScriptRefAlias: Sanity checks for the battle manager attack variables. (Bug #14369)
